And we know that for skewed data the median is the best measure to describe the location. So here the median would be best measure of position.Top quartile means top 25% of the data. Here the total number of mice are 40 so top quartile consists of (40*25%) = 10 mice. Now 40% of them survived so (10*40%) = 4 mice survived.The percentile would give us what percent of the mice are in that category. So in this example it will pin point the information we are looking for.The quartile is somewhat similar to percentile. The percentile divides the whole group into 100 equal parts and the quartiles into 4 equal parts. So quartiles would give the 25 percentiles information.The standard score will give us the relative measures. It will give enough information to compare to different scores by standardizing them.
